Now we’re working on a big mouse driven etch-a-sketch

May 18, 2008 by tommcguire

Lee and I are starting to get the whole thing clabored together but first and formost functional. Here’s a look at the function of user interface. I found this cleaver interface for the Arduino that will take signals from a computor mouse. Then we send signals to the stepper motor drives. Apply power…have fun.

Paint a wheel

February 3, 2008 by tommcguire

OK I got some paint on a wheel. Not too bad I think. There is speed control on the motor too but the string is noisy. I think I’m going to have to put felt in the groves.
